Do Now ANSWERS
Advantages of a computer network:
We can share software, files and data.
We can share hardware.
3. We can communicate over long distances.
Disadvantages of a computer network:
1.If the network breaks, it makes tasks more difficult.
2. We expose ourselves to hackers and viruses.
We expose ourselves to cyber bullies.

Topologynoun
top-ol-ogy
The arrangement and interlinking of computers in a computer network
"the topology of a computer network"
5
LAN
Local Area Network
6
​A LAN (local area network) is a network of computers within the same building, such as a school, home or business. A LAN is not necessarily connected to the internet
7
WAN
Wide Area Network
8
A WAN (wide area network) is created when LANs are connected. This requires media such as broadband cables, and can connect up organisations based in different geographical places. The internet is a WAN.
